Driver's License Suspension in Ohio

Even though penalties like jail time and stage fines might arrive at thoughts as key penalties of the DUI charge, there are actually other penalties that may be just as problematic. When any person in Ohio is arrested for a drunk driving offense, they confront an automated administrative suspension of their driver's license. This action is taken with the Bureau of Motor Cars (BMV), and is particularly consequently independent of any following prison penalties.

You will find possibilities available to alleged offenders, nevertheless, which could temporarily restore limited driving privileges while awaiting the resolution in their fees in courtroom. Inside thirty days from the arrest, the motive force can submit a created ask for for the hearing to dismiss the suspension. This administrative Listening to will analyze evidence and witnesses to find out if the motive force's license need to be restored. Selected components, for example incorrect protocol during the website traffic end or arrest might cause a reinstatement of driving privileges. The result of the civil review isn't going to effects any criminal proceedings.

A driver's license suspension are unable to always be lifted, even so. In a few situations a revocation of driving talents is mandated by Ohio's guidelines. When a drive is detained on a suspicion of DUI, officers may request a breath, blood, or urine sample to investigate for blood Alcoholic beverages content. Ohio Revised Code 4511.191 clarifies that the driving force is legally capable of refuse to supply a sample, but this refusal carries effects. The penalties for refusing to provide a sample for tests fluctuate depending on the alleged offender's prior history. For a primary refusal, the driver's license will be suspended for a person 12 months.

Needless to say, a DUI conviction also carries the possibility of a license suspension. To start with time offenders will confront a revocation between 6 months and three years, based upon factors for instance their BAC amount. For any 2nd DUI offense, formally known as OVI in Ohio, a conviction implies a license suspension from one to five yrs.

In a few suspension of driver's license cases, a convicted offender could possibly apply for a temporary hardship license. This allow enables the motive force minimal driving qualities which generally contain occupational, educational, or medical applications. The motive force may additionally be necessary to install special license plates or an ignition interlock machine on their car in Trade for these constrained driving privileges.

Once the identified suspension time period is around, an offender's license will not be quickly reinstated. The method differs with regards to the mother nature in the suspension, but offenders are going to be want to finish steps including shelling out a re-instatement charge, retaking a driver's license evaluation, finish many types, and provide proof of insurance policies into the BMV.
